Fostering Empathy and Social Responsibility

At its core, community service fosters empathy and social responsibility. When individuals engage in volunteer work, they step into the shoes of those they are helping, gaining insight into the challenges and struggles faced by members of their community. This firsthand experience cultivates a deep sense of empathy and compassion.

Moreover, community service instills a sense of social responsibility. Volunteers recognize that they are not passive bystanders but active contributors to the well-being of their community. This realization encourages them to take ownership of local issues and actively seek solutions, ultimately leading to the betterment of society.

Strengthening the Bonds of Community

Community service is a powerful bonding agent, bringing together people from diverse backgrounds and walks of life for a common cause. Individuals unite to address community needs and form lasting connections, forging a sense of belonging and unity. These connections extend beyond volunteer projects, creating a supportive network of individuals committed to making a difference.

Volunteering also strengthens the intergenerational bonds within a community. When parents involve their children in volunteer activities, they pass on the values of empathy and social responsibility to the next generation, ensuring the continuity of a caring and involved society.

Addressing Critical Needs

Community service plays a pivotal role in addressing critical needs within communities. Volunteers can contribute their time, skills, and resources to support local organizations, charities, and nonprofits working to combat poverty, homelessness, educational disparities, and environmental concerns.

By actively participating in community service, individuals become part of the solution to these pressing challenges. They bridge gaps in services, raise awareness about important issues, and provide essential support to those in need. As a result, the quality of life in their communities improves significantly.

Personal Growth and Skill Development

Engaging in community service is not only beneficial to the community but also for the individuals involved. Volunteering provides a unique platform for personal growth and skill development. Volunteers acquire many skills, including leadership, teamwork, communication, problem-solving, and project management.

These skills not only enrich the lives of volunteers but also enhance their employability. Many employers value candidates with a strong history of community service, as it demonstrates qualities like teamwork, empathy, and social responsibility. In this way, community service can open doors to professional opportunities and career advancement.

Building Resilient Communities

Community service contributes to building resilient communities capable of facing challenges and crises effectively. Volunteers often play crucial roles in providing assistance and support in natural disasters, economic downturns, or public health emergencies. Their dedication and readiness to help create a sense of solidarity that enables communities to bounce back and recover more swiftly.

By engaging in community service regularly, individuals and communities become better prepared to handle unexpected situations, fostering resilience and adaptability in the face of adversity.
